A disability Justice Perspective

I like how we state that in Disability Justice, "we ‘hold a vision born out of collective struggle drawing upon the legacies of cultural and spiritual resistance within a thousand underground paths, igniting small persistent fires of rebellion in everyday life” As we begin deconstructing and reconstructing societies where everyone regardless of their disability is a valued member. Through disability studies I discovered how the narrative of disabled people begins to shift from pity, needy to legacies of resistances, activism etc. While disability pride movement have also brought us to a place where we begin to challenge the notion or “normal” as the measurement by which everyone else is judged to a place of reclaiming our bodies and gaining pride in both the pains and pleasures associated with disabilities like every other bodies.
